Turkmenistan successfully implements large-scale projects

By Aynur Jafarova

Turkmenistan successfully implements large-scale projects of national and international importance.

This remark was made by Turkmen President Gurbanguly Berdymukhamedov at a cabinet meeting, local media reported.

"Intensive construction of more than 2,000 different buildings and structures worth over $45 billion is underway in Turkmenistan," the president noted.

The Turkmen leader also said currently, the construction of the North-South transnational railway, which will connect the regions of the continent, has been completed.

Works on the development and improvement of oil and gas fields, large gas pipelines, air harbors, highways and large bridges are underway in the country as well.

Turkmenistan also has some 237 projects worth nearly $4 billion which have been put into operation in the country in the first 9 months of 2014.

Turkmenistan is gradually passing to market economy. This was reflected in the constitution. The country achieves impressive success in the implementation of its socio-economic strategy. The GDP per capita in the country amounted to $19,000.

Since early 2014, Turkmenistan's foreign trade turnover has exceeded $21 billion. The investments made in the various sectors of the national economy increased by 8.3 percent in the first six months of 2014 compared to the same period of 2013.

The country will construct around 419 large facilities worth over $9 billion by late 2014.
